Can you recommend any good books on Business Strategy?

I'm a big advocate of 'learning on the job', but why limit yourself to your own experiences? If you know of any particularly good business strategy books, I'd love to find out about them so I can add them to my own reading list :)

Daniel Kahneman, "Thinking Fast and Slow"

This book deals especially with the topic of decision making, including using simple algorithms as strategies in business and everyday life.

The Lean Startup. It's almost too obvious but it really does offer some great insight into how to focus and test your hypotheses.

